- Abstract:
- Original holograph manuscript of The Return of the Native by Thomas Hardy. First published in 1878, was Hardy’s 6th novel. It initially appeared as a 12-part series in the magazine Belgravia, where its somewhat controversial thematic content caused a stir. Subsequently, it has become one of... [ … ]

- Abstract:
- Ellis (b.1965, Cornwall, England) studied sculpture in England and trained as a conservator. He moved to Ireland in 1994 and set up a successful conservation practice. Since 2007 he has devoted himself full-time to making sculpture. The work, over 7 metres high, was commissioned for the Roebuck... [ … ]
